Transaction 7edb65f20aee2f34c070ef495d56d3ec1619b8f592337a0f326a1f682b7054e9
1 Input
1 Output
-
7edb65f20aee2f34c070ef495d56d3ec1619b8f592337a0f326a1f682b7054e9:0
- value
- 2989806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a82b3e1f5216178cff161dc882fe5132fec3af9 OP_EQUAL
- address
- 3BQC8Fw3K4AtH9WgVbnx2swjgwrMoFeWSe